-/* Copyright (c) 2009, 2010. The SimGrid Team.
+/* Copyright (c) 2009-2014. The SimGrid Team.
* All rights reserved. */
/* This program is free software; you can redistribute it and/or modify it
sprintf(to, "%s_%s", MSG_process_get_name(MSG_process_self()), action[2]);
- ACT_DEBUG("Entering Send: %s (size: %lg)", NAME, size);
+ ACT_DEBUG("Entering Send: %s (size: %g)", NAME, size);
if (size < 65536) {
action_Isend(action);
} else {
/* Check the given arguments */
MSG_init(&argc, argv);
+ /* Explicit initialization of the action module is required now*/
+ MSG_action_init();
+
if (argc < 3) {
printf("Usage: %s platform_file deployment_file [action_files]\n", argv[0]);
printf
XBT_INFO("Simulation time %g", MSG_get_clock());
+ /* Explicit finalization of the action module is required now*/
+ MSG_action_exit();
+
if (res == MSG_OK)
return 0;
else